In response to message posted by Red: Hi Mary, Hudson's Bay tea and Labrador tea are the same thing, and when it's in bloom the bears love the blossoms. They seem to make them drunken, but have no effect on us humans, other than making the tea look prettier. Have a great Easter weekend with those boys, Mary!
